FDG PET detection of unknown primary tumors

Summary

Fluorodeoxyglucose Positron Emission Tomography (FDG PET) helps identify primary cancer sites in about one-third of patients with unknown primary origin. This imaging technique aids in guiding biopsies and selecting treatments for better patient outcomes.
